Mycobacterium Tuberculosis Qualitative PCR
Introduction to the Test
The Mycobacterium Tuberculosis Qualitative PCR test is a cutting-edge diagnostic tool designed to detect the presence of Mycobacterium tuberculosis, the bacterium responsible for tuberculosis (TB). This test is crucial for timely diagnosis and treatment, especially in regions where TB is prevalent. It utilizes Real-Time Polymerase Chain Reaction (PCR) technology to provide accurate results within a short turnaround time of 3-4 days.
What the Test Measures
This test specifically measures the genetic material of Mycobacterium tuberculosis in various sample types, including:
- CSF (Cerebrospinal Fluid)
- EMT (Exudative Material from Tuberculosis)
- Tissue samples
- Knee Aspirate Fluid
- Pleural Fluid
- Ascitic Fluid
- PUS
- Sputum
- BAL (Bronchoalveolar Lavage) Fluid
- Menstrual Blood
- Cervical Fluid
- Synovial Fluid
This comprehensive analysis helps in confirming or ruling out TB infections.
Who Should Consider This Test?
This test is recommended for:
- Individuals exhibiting symptoms of tuberculosis, such as persistent cough, fever, night sweats, and weight loss.
- People with a history of exposure to TB or those living in areas with high TB prevalence.
- Patients undergoing evaluation for respiratory symptoms.

Understanding Your Results
Once the test is completed, results will indicate the presence or absence of Mycobacterium tuberculosis. A positive result suggests an active TB infection, while a negative result indicates that TB is not detected. However, further clinical evaluation may be necessary based on individual health circumstances.
